_D_e_s_c_r_i_p_t_i_o_n:

     This function is used for 2D spatial location normalization, using
     the robust local regression function 'loess'.  It should be used
     as an argument to the main normalization function 'maNormMain'.

_U_s_a_g_e:

     maNorm2D(x="maSpotRow", y="maSpotCol", z="maM", g="maPrintTip", w=NULL,
     subset=TRUE, span=0.4, ...)

_A_r_g_u_m_e_n_t_s:

       x: Name of accessor method for spot row coordinates, usually
          'maSpotRow'.

       y: Name of accessor method for spot column coordinates, usually
          'maSpotCol'.

       z: Name of accessor method for spot statistics, usually the
          log-ratio 'maM'.

       g: Name of accessor method for print-tip-group indices, usually
          'maPrintTip'.

       w: An optional numeric vector of weights.

  subset: A "logical" or "numeric" vector indicating the subset of
          points used to compute the fits. 

    span: The argument 'span' which controls the degree of smoothing in
          the  'loess' function.

     ...: Misc arguments

_D_e_t_a_i_l_s:

     The spot statistic named in 'z' is regressed on spot row and
     column coordinates, separately within print-tip-group, using the
     'loess' function.

_V_a_l_u_e:

     A function with bindings for the above arguments. This latter
     function takes as argument an object of class '"marrayRaw"' (or
     possibly '"marrayNorm"'), and returns a vector of fitted values to
     be substracted from the raw log-ratios. It calls the function
     'ma2D', which is not specific to microarray objects.
